Enhancing Quality of Life Through Robotic Assistance

Promoting Independence

One of the primary ways robotic assistance enhances the quality of life for the elderly is by promoting their independence. Robots designed for personal care can assist with daily tasks such as bathing, dressing, and meal preparation. By alleviating the burden of these activities, elderly individuals can maintain a sense of autonomy that is crucial for their mental well-being. Furthermore, robots can remind seniors to take medications on time or even facilitate virtual medical consultations, thus empowering them to manage their health without constant supervision from caregivers.

Companionship and Emotional Support

Another significant benefit of robotic assistance is the provision of companionship. Social isolation is a common issue among the elderly, which can lead to depression and cognitive decline. Advanced social robots are equipped with artificial intelligence that enables them to engage in meaningful conversations, recognize emotions, and even respond to the needs of their users. This emotional support can significantly enhance the overall quality of life by reducing feelings of loneliness and providing an interactive outlet. Moreover, some robots can facilitate connections with family and friends through video calls, thereby further bridging the gap that often exists in elderly care.

Addressing Challenges in Senior Care with Innovative Robotics

Improving Safety and Fall Prevention

One of the critical challenges in senior care is ensuring the safety of elderly individuals, particularly concerning fall prevention. Robotics technology plays a vital role in this aspect by providing supportive devices that can assist seniors in moving safely throughout their living spaces. For instance, robotic exoskeletons can offer physical support and enhance mobility, allowing seniors to walk with greater stability. Additionally, smart sensors integrated within the home environment can detect falls in real-time and alert caregivers or emergency services, significantly improving response times and outcomes in critical situations.

Streamlining Health Monitoring and Care Management

Another area where robotics addresses challenges in senior care is in health monitoring and overall care management. Robots equipped with advanced monitoring systems can track vital signs, medication adherence, and daily activities. These systems not only provide valuable data for healthcare providers but also empower seniors to take an active role in their health management. By automating routine checks and reminders, robotic solutions help minimize human error and ensure that seniors receive timely interventions when necessary. This proactive approach enhances the quality of care and helps maintain the health and well-being of elderly individuals, making it easier for them to age in place comfortably.

The Evolution of Elderly Support: A Robotic Revolution

Historical Context and Technological Advancements

The journey of integrating robotics into elderly care has evolved significantly over the years. Initially, technology aimed at assisting the elderly focused on simple assistive devices like walkers and wheelchairs. However, with advancements in artificial intelligence and machine learning, modern robots are now capable of performing complex tasks that enhance daily living for seniors. For example, robots can now understand natural language, recognize faces, and learn about individual preferences. This evolution reflects a shift towards creating personalized care solutions that not only meet physical needs but also cater to emotional well-being, ultimately leading to a more enriched life for older adults.

Future Prospects of Robotic Integration in Elderly Care

As we look towards the future, the potential of robotics in elderly care continues to expand. Innovations such as telepresence robots are already making it possible for healthcare providers to interact with patients remotely, allowing for timely consultations without the need for physical presence. Additionally, researchers are exploring advanced features like emotion detection and adaptive behaviors in robots to better understand and respond to the unique needs of elderly individuals. Empowering Seniors: How Robotics is Transforming Elderly Care

Enhancing Daily Living Activities

One of the most impactful ways robotics is empowering seniors is by enhancing their ability to perform daily living activities. Robots designed for assistive functions can help with tasks such as cooking, cleaning, and mobility assistance. By automating these chores, seniors can experience a renewed sense of independence and self-sufficiency. This not only alleviates the physical strain associated with such tasks but also contributes to improved mental health. Additionally, the use of robotic systems can significantly reduce the risk of accidents, allowing seniors to live more confidently in their own homes.

Facilitating Social Engagement and Interaction

Another crucial aspect of how robotics empowers seniors is through the facilitation of social engagement. Social robots are increasingly being utilized to combat feelings of loneliness and isolation that many elderly individuals face. These robots have the capacity to initiate conversations, play games, and even remind users of family events, thereby fostering stronger connections and encouraging social interaction. By bridging the gap between seniors and their loved ones, technology helps maintain meaningful relationships, which is essential for emotional well-being. Furthermore, with advanced communication features such as video conferencing, seniors can effortlessly connect with family members and friends, enriching their social lives and ensuring they feel supported and connected.
